Abstract

Triple‐negative breast cancer (TNBC) has become a common tumor that harms women's physical and mental health, as characterized by a relatively rapid recurrence and a high incidence of brain metastasis. Research increasingly suggests that microRNAs play key roles in the progress of TNBC. However, the function of miR‐6838‐5p in TNBC has not yet been reported, and requires additional exploration.
